Radio access network over fiber (ROF) technology combines wireless and fiber-optic technology to improve the efficiency of use of these technologies. The main problem in designing DWDM transport networks is the wavelength assignment of light paths. One way of solving this problem is to use the algorithm BCO-RWA. However, BCO-RWA has the following disadvantage: during calculating route selecting probability, base algorithm do not take into account the nonlinear four-wave mixing phenomenon. In this paper we present an algorithm which takes into modifications introduced in the algorithm.
